What is the main structural characteristic of sterols?

  1. A ring-like structure that is highly hydrophobic and structurally rigid

  2. Linear chains of unsaturated fatty acids

  3. Single-stranded DNA-like structure

  4. Double-helical structure typical of proteins

The correct answer is: A ring-like structure that is highly hydrophobic and structurally rigid

Sterols are a type of lipid with a unique ring-like structure that is highly hydrophobic and structurally rigid. This structure is what gives sterols their characteristic properties and functions, such as regulating membrane fluidity and serving as precursors for hormone synthesis. Linear chains of unsaturated fatty acids (option B) do not possess this unique ring structure and do not have the same functions as sterols. Single-stranded DNA (option C) and double-helical structure typical of proteins (option D) refer to completely different biomolecules and are not considered structural characteristics of sterols. Therefore, the main structural characteristic of sterols is a ring-like structure that is highly hydrophobic and structurally rigid.
